Olympic Medalist Audun Groenvold Dead At 49, Killed By Lightning Strike

TMZ.com Wednesday, 16 July 2025 ()
Olympic freestyle skier Audun Groenvold -- who won bronze at the 2010 Vancouver Games -- died this week after he was struck by lightning. The Norwegian ski federation announced the tragic news on Wednesday ... explaining the athlete was hit by a…

Parisians take a historic plunge into the River Seine after more than a century

Parisians take a historic plunge into the River Seine after more than a century The return to swimming follows a 1.4 billion euro cleanup project tied to last year’s Olympics. Officials now say the Seine meets European water quality standards on most days.
